Transaction 89bfd798f4e7f02c82b24a4301fb0cf6e40f65e3748f5abc8a0648a02fc38f5e

block
26772117e796704cf15fa95d00a702cf8eb3e78e6062c180fbc3a55b04850cb5

1 Input

5 Outputs